– Understanding the ⁤Ingredients in⁣ Mountain Dew Energy Drinks

When it comes to Mountain Dew Energy Drinks, it’s important to understand the ingredients that make ​up these popular beverages. While many people enjoy the⁤ boost of energy they provide,⁣ it’s⁣ essential to be aware of ‌what you’re putting into your body. Here’s a breakdown of some of the key ingredients‌ found in Mountain⁣ Dew Energy Drinks:

  • Caffeine: One of‍ the main ingredients in Mountain Dew Energy Drinks, caffeine is known for its‌ ability to ‌increase ⁣alertness and boost energy levels. However, it’s essential to ‍consume ⁣caffeine in ⁣moderation, as excessive intake can lead to negative⁢ side effects such as insomnia and jitters.

  • Sugar: Like many other ⁢energy drinks, Mountain Dew contains a⁤ high ⁤amount of sugar, which can contribute to weight gain and other health issues when​ consumed in ‌excess.⁢ It’s important to‍ be mindful of your sugar intake and ‍look for healthier alternatives if you’re trying to ​cut back.

  • B-Vitamins: Mountain Dew Energy Drinks also ⁣contain a variety of B-vitamins, which are essential for‍ converting food into⁤ energy and supporting overall health. While these vitamins‍ can be beneficial in moderation, it’s important to ​remember​ that a balanced diet rich in​ whole foods ⁤is the best way to ensure you’re getting all the⁣ nutrients you need.

By understanding​ the ingredients in Mountain⁣ Dew Energy Drinks, you can make informed choices about whether or not ​they’re right for ​you.⁤ It’s⁢ always a good idea ‌to consult with a healthcare ​professional or nutritionist⁣ if you have any concerns ⁣about⁣ your ⁤caffeine or sugar intake.

– Exploring⁤ the Potential‌ Health Effects of Mountain Dew Energy⁣ Drinks

Mountain Dew Energy drinks have become a popular choice for those looking ‌to boost their energy levels and stay awake ⁢during long⁣ hours ​of work or study. However, many people are left wondering about the ⁣potential‌ health⁢ effects of consuming⁤ these beverages regularly. ⁤

One of the ‍main concerns ⁣surrounding Mountain Dew Energy drinks⁤ is their ⁤high sugar content. These drinks are packed with sugar, which can‌ lead to weight gain, tooth decay, and an increased ⁣risk of developing chronic diseases such as diabetes and heart disease. In addition to sugar,⁣ Mountain Dew Energy ⁣drinks ‍also ‍contain high levels of caffeine, which can lead to insomnia,​ anxiety, ‌and‍ even heart palpitations if consumed in excess.

On the⁣ flip side, some people argue⁣ that ⁣the added‍ vitamins ​and⁢ minerals ‌in Mountain Dew Energy drinks can provide a slight boost to your overall health. However, these benefits are‌ often ‌outweighed by the⁤ negative effects of the sugar​ and⁢ caffeine content.⁣ Overall, ‍it is important to ​consume Mountain Dew Energy drinks in moderation and be aware of the potential ⁢health⁤ risks associated with frequent consumption.

– Seeking Alternative Energy-Boosting Options to Mountain​ Dew Energy ⁣Drinks

When looking ‌for alternative energy-boosting options to‌ Mountain Dew Energy Drinks, it’s important to ‌consider the potential health impacts associated with consuming such beverages. While Mountain Dew‌ Energy Drinks may provide a​ quick pick-me-up, they are often‍ loaded with artificial ingredients, high levels ⁣of sugar, and caffeine. These additives⁢ can lead to ​negative side effects such‌ as jitteriness, increased heart rate, and even potential long-term health problems.

Instead of relying⁢ on⁣ sugary energy ⁣drinks, consider⁣ incorporating natural alternatives into your routine. Options such ‌as green tea, matcha, and yerba​ mate can provide a sustainable ⁣energy boost without the crash typically associated with traditional energy drinks.‍ Additionally, these alternatives offer antioxidant benefits and a more ⁢gradual release of energy throughout the day.

To further enhance ⁢your energy ⁢levels, ‌focus on maintaining a balanced diet rich in whole foods and nutrients. Incorporating protein-rich snacks,⁤ hydrating with plenty of water, and ⁢getting regular exercise can⁤ all ⁣contribute to sustained energy⁢ levels without⁢ the need for artificial stimulants. By making ⁤conscious choices⁣ about what​ you put into​ your body, you can fuel yourself in a⁤ way ​that supports your overall ​health and well-being.
